Can bladder cancer be cured?

The overall cure rate for early-stage bladder cancer is relatively high, but if the tumor is accompanied by multiple metastases and is at a relatively late stage, it is generally incurable. After diagnosis, surgical treatment should be the first choice if there are surgical indications. After surgery, intravesical chemotherapy should be performed to reduce the chance of postoperative recurrence. The survival rate of invasive bladder cancer within 5 years after cystectomy is extremely high, and this rate is still relatively high. Therefore, whether it is invasive bladder cancer or non-invasive bladder cancer, some patients can be cured in the early stages, but this does not rule out postoperative recurrence or metastasis. The prognosis of bladder cancer should be preliminarily judged based on its specific condition. The treatment and prognosis of bladder tumors are related to the stage and grade of the tumor, the multiple lesions of the tumor, the size of the tumor and the early recurrence rate.
